Melatonin is a hormone that helps regulate your body’s sleep-wake cycle.

Hormones are chemical messengers that allow different parts of the body to communicate with each other. For example:

  • Insulin helps regulate blood sugar.
  • Thyroid hormones help control metabolism.
  • Adrenaline prepares your body to respond to stress.
  • Melatonin signals that it’s time to prepare for sleep.

Unlike medicines, melatonin is produced naturally by your body. As daylight fades, your brain releases more melatonin into your bloodstream. Levels remain high during the night and fall again as morning approaches, helping maintain your daily sleep-wake rhythm.

Most of the melatonin involved in sleep is produced by the pineal gland, a tiny structure located near the center of the brain.

As darkness falls, your eyes detect the reduction in light and send signals to your body’s master clock, known as the suprachiasmatic nucleus (SCN). The SCN then signals the pineal gland to release melatonin.

During the day, melatonin production remains low. As night approaches, it rises naturally, which is why melatonin is often called the “hormone of darkness.”

Science Snapshot

Your brain doesn’t check a watch to know when it’s bedtime.

Instead, it measures light. Less light means more melatonin. More light means less melatonin.

No.

Although the pineal gland produces the melatonin responsible for regulating sleep, scientists have found smaller amounts of melatonin in other parts of the body, including the:

  • Digestive tract
  • Eyes
  • Bone marrow
  • Skin
  • Immune cells

Researchers believe these locally produced forms of melatonin help protect cells and support normal body functions. However, the melatonin released by the pineal gland remains the most important for regulating sleep.

That’s because your body has its own internal timing system, known as the circadian rhythm.

Melatonin is one of the key hormones that helps keep this system running on time.

Your Body Has a Built-In Clock

Deep inside your brain is a small group of nerve cells called the suprachiasmatic nucleus (SCN). You don’t need to remember the name, but it’s helpful to know its role.

The SCN acts as your body’s master clock, coordinating many daily functions, including:

  • When you feel sleepy
  • When you wake up
  • Body temperature
  • Hormone release
  • Hunger and digestion
  • Mental alertness

Rather than controlling these processes directly, the SCN keeps them working together on a roughly 24-hour schedule.

How Does Your Brain Know It’s Day or Night?

Your brain relies on light, not the time on your watch.

Special light-sensitive cells in your eyes constantly monitor the amount of light around you and send that information to the SCN.

During the day:

  • Bright light reaches your eyes.
  • The SCN suppresses melatonin production.
  • You stay more alert.

As evening approaches:

  • Light levels fall.
  • The SCN recognizes that night is approaching.
  • It signals the pineal gland to release melatonin.
  • Your body begins preparing for sleep.

This entire process happens automatically every day.

From Light to Sleep

The pathway is surprisingly simple:

Light decreases → Eyes detect darkness → SCN receives the signal → Pineal gland releases melatonin → Melatonin levels rise → Your body prepares for sleep

This is why exposure to light plays such an important role in regulating your sleep-wake cycle.

StepWhat Happens
1. Light enters your eyesYour brain measures the amount of light around you.
2. The master clock respondsThe SCN decides whether it’s day or night.
3. Melatonin is releasedAs darkness increases, the pineal gland produces melatonin.
4. Your body prepares for sleepAlertness decreases, and your body begins its nighttime routine.
5. Morning light arrivesMelatonin production falls, helping you become more awake.

Why Bright Light at Night Can Delay Sleep

Bright light in the evening—especially from phones, tablets, computers, and other screens—can delay melatonin release.

As a result, your brain receives signals that it’s still daytime, making it harder to fall asleep.

Reducing screen exposure before bed or lowering screen brightness can help your body’s natural melatonin rhythm.

Melatonin’s most important job is helping regulate your internal body clock, but it also has several other functions in the body.

1. It Helps Regulate Your Sleep-Wake Cycle

This is melatonin’s primary and best-understood role.

As evening becomes darker, your brain releases more melatonin. Rising melatonin levels tell your body that it’s time to prepare for sleep. In the morning, exposure to light suppresses melatonin production, helping you become more alert.

Without this daily rhythm, it would be much harder for your body to maintain a regular sleep schedule.

Evidence Strength: Strong

2. It Helps Keep Your Circadian Rhythm on Time

Melatonin doesn’t just make you feel sleepy. It also helps keep your circadian rhythm synchronized with the 24-hour day.

This becomes especially important when your body clock is disrupted, such as during:

  • Jet lag
  • Night-shift work
  • Delayed sleep phase disorder
  • Irregular sleep schedules

In these situations, properly timed melatonin may help your body adjust more quickly.

Evidence Strength: Strong for certain circadian rhythm disorders.

3. It Acts as an Antioxidant

Melatonin also functions as an antioxidant.

Antioxidants help protect cells from damage caused by unstable molecules called free radicals. Cell damage happens naturally as we age and is also influenced by pollution, smoking, inflammation, and other factors.

Laboratory studies suggest that melatonin can help reduce this type of damage.

However, most of this evidence comes from laboratory and animal studies. Scientists are still studying how much this effect benefits human health.

Evidence Strength: Moderate for antioxidant activity; limited evidence for routine health benefits in healthy adults.

4. It May Support the Immune System

Researchers have found that melatonin interacts with several parts of the immune system.

Some studies suggest it may help regulate immune responses and inflammation.

However, this doesn’t mean taking melatonin will “boost” your immune system or prevent infections.

That claim is not supported by strong clinical evidence.

Evidence Strength: Emerging

5. It May Influence Other Hormones

Melatonin communicates with several hormone systems in the body.

Researchers are studying how it may influence:

  • Reproductive hormones
  • Stress hormones
  • Metabolism
  • Body temperature regulation

These interactions are complex and continue to be investigated.

At present, melatonin supplements are not recommended simply to improve hormone balance.

Evidence Strength: Limited to Moderate, depending on the condition.

6. Researchers Are Studying Many Other Possible Benefits

Because melatonin is found throughout the body, scientists are exploring whether it could play a role in many different medical conditions.

What Does This Mean for You?

The strongest scientific evidence supports melatonin’s role in regulating the sleep-wake cycle and helping certain circadian rhythm disorders, such as jet lag and delayed sleep-wake phase disorder.

Many of its other proposed benefits—including healthy aging, brain protection, and immune support—are promising but not yet supported by enough high-quality clinical evidence to recommend melatonin for these purposes.

That’s why it’s important to distinguish between proven uses and areas of active research.

Some advertisements describe melatonin as a “miracle hormone” that can improve nearly every aspect of health. Current scientific evidence does not support those claims.

As research continues, scientists may discover additional benefits. Until then, melatonin should be viewed as an important hormone with a few well-established uses and several promising—but still unproven—areas of research.

Your body naturally produces melatonin every day.

So why do melatonin supplements exist?

The answer is simple.

Sometimes, your body produces melatonin at the wrong time, or the natural signal isn’t strong enough to help your sleep schedule. In certain situations, taking melatonin as a supplement may help shift or reinforce that signal.

However, a supplement is not the same as the melatonin your body naturally makes.

Let’s look at the differences.

Your Body’s Natural Melatonin

Natural melatonin is made by your pineal gland in response to darkness.

Your brain carefully controls:

  • When melatonin is released
  • How much is released
  • How long it stays elevated
  • When production stops in the morning

This process happens automatically every day.

In healthy adults, melatonin usually starts rising 2–3 hours before your usual bedtime, reaches its highest level during the night, and falls again after sunrise.

Your body adjusts this timing based on your exposure to light and your internal clock.

Melatonin Supplements

Melatonin supplements contain manufactured melatonin that is designed to work like the hormone your body naturally produces.

After you take a supplement, it is absorbed into your bloodstream and reaches your brain, where it acts on melatonin receptors.

Unlike your body’s own melatonin, a supplement cannot perfectly copy your natural nightly rhythm.

Instead, it provides an extra melatonin signal, which may help in certain situations.

Natural Melatonin vs. Supplement: A Quick Comparison

FeatureNatural MelatoninMelatonin Supplement
SourceMade by your pineal glandManufactured for medical use
TriggerDarknessTaken by mouth or other forms
TimingControlled by your body clockControlled by when you take it
AmountRegulated naturallyDepends on the product and dose
Main purposeRegulates sleep-wake cycleMay help adjust sleep timing in some people

Different Types of Melatonin Supplements

Not all melatonin products work the same way.

Immediate-Release Melatonin

This type dissolves quickly after you take it.

It raises melatonin levels rapidly and is mainly used for people who have difficulty falling asleep.

Extended-Release (Prolonged-Release) Melatonin

This form releases melatonin slowly over several hours.

It is designed to more closely mimic the body’s natural overnight melatonin pattern.

Some people who wake frequently during the night may benefit from this type, although it is not appropriate for everyone.

Does a Higher Dose Work Better?

Many people assume that taking more melatonin will produce better sleep.

Research suggests that this is often not true.

Once melatonin receptors are activated, taking a much larger dose may not provide additional benefit. Instead, higher doses may increase the chance of side effects such as:

  • Morning drowsiness
  • Headache
  • Dizziness
  • Vivid dreams

For many people, a low dose taken at the right time works better than a high dose taken at the wrong time.

Are All Melatonin Supplements the Same?

No.

The quality of melatonin supplements can vary.

Studies have found that the actual amount of melatonin in some products may differ from what is listed on the label. Some products have also been found to contain unwanted ingredients or inconsistent amounts between batches.

Because of this, it’s wise to:

  • Buy from well-known manufacturers.
  • Choose products that have undergone independent quality testing when available.
  • Avoid products that make unrealistic health claims.

Melatonin works best when the problem is related to your body’s internal clock (circadian rhythm) rather than sleep itself.

Let’s look at the groups that may benefit.

1. People with Jet Lag

Evidence Strength: Strong

Jet lag happens when you travel quickly across several time zones.

Your body clock still follows the time at your departure city, even though the local time has changed.

For example, if you fly from New York to London, your body may think it’s only evening when it’s already midnight in London.

This can cause:

  • Difficulty falling asleep
  • Waking too early
  • Daytime tiredness
  • Poor concentration

Taking melatonin at the correct local bedtime after arriving may help your body adjust faster and reduce jet lag symptoms.

Best suited for:

  • Travelers crossing multiple time zones, especially eastward travel.

2. People with Delayed Sleep-Wake Phase Disorder (DSWPD)

Evidence Strength: Strong

Some people naturally feel sleepy very late at night.

They may not fall asleep until 2:00 a.m. or 3:00 a.m., even if they go to bed much earlier.

As a result, waking up for work or school becomes difficult.

This condition is called Delayed Sleep-Wake Phase Disorder (DSWPD).

For these individuals, carefully timed melatonin—often taken several hours before their desired bedtime—may help shift the body clock earlier.Timing is critical. Taking melatonin too late may reduce its benefit.

3. Some Shift Workers

Evidence Strength: Moderate

Night-shift workers often need to sleep during the day when their body expects to be awake.

Examples include:

  • Nurses
  • Doctors
  • Police officers
  • Factory workers
  • Security staff

Some studies suggest melatonin may help certain shift workers fall asleep after a night shift.

However, results have been mixed.

Shift workers also benefit from:

  • Wearing sunglasses on the way home after a night shift.
  • Sleeping in a dark, quiet room.
  • Following a consistent sleep schedule whenever possible.

Melatonin should be viewed as one part of a broader strategy, not the only solution.

4. Older Adults with Low Melatonin Production

Evidence Strength: Moderate

Natural melatonin production often decreases with age.

Some older adults experience:

  • Difficulty falling asleep
  • Earlier morning waking
  • Lighter sleep

For selected older adults, especially those with insomnia related to reduced melatonin production, prolonged-release melatonin may improve sleep quality.

However, not every sleep problem in older adults is caused by low melatonin.

Pain, medications, medical conditions, and sleep disorders are often equally important.

5. Some Blind Individuals

Evidence Strength: Strong

Many people who are completely blind cannot detect light.

Without light signals reaching the brain, the body’s internal clock may gradually drift out of sync with the normal 24-hour day.

This can cause irregular sleep patterns.

Melatonin may help synchronize the sleep-wake cycle in some of these individuals.

Treatment should be supervised by a healthcare professional.

6. Some Children with Neurodevelopmental Disorders

Evidence Strength: Moderate to Strong (for selected conditions)

Some children with conditions such as:

  • Autism spectrum disorder (ASD)
  • Attention-deficit/hyperactivity disorder (ADHD)
  • Certain developmental disorders

may experience significant sleep difficulties.

For selected children, melatonin may improve sleep onset and total sleep time.

However:

  • It should only be used under medical supervision.
  • The child’s sleep habits should also be addressed.
  • The lowest effective dose should be used.

Melatonin should never be started regularly in children without discussing it with a pediatrician or sleep specialist.

7. Certain Circadian Rhythm Sleep Disorders

Evidence Strength: Strong

Melatonin may benefit people with other circadian rhythm disorders where the body’s internal clock is out of sync with daily life.

These conditions are less common but are recognized by sleep specialists.

Treatment usually combines:

  • Correct timing of melatonin
  • Bright light therapy
  • Good sleep hygiene
  • A regular sleep schedule

Melatonin can interact with certain medications. While many interactions are mild, some may affect how medicines work or increase the risk of side effects.

Common examples include:

  • Blood thinners (anticoagulants)
  • Diabetes medications
  • Blood pressure medicines
  • Sedatives and sleeping pills
  • Some antidepressants
  • Medicines that affect the immune system

This doesn’t mean melatonin cannot be used, but it should be discussed with your healthcare provider.

Medication TypePossible Concern
Blood thinnersIncreased bleeding risk
SedativesExcessive drowsiness
Diabetes medicinesPossible effect on blood sugar
Blood pressure medicinesMay alter blood pressure response

Never stop or change a prescribed medicine without medical advice.

One of the biggest concerns people have is whether melatonin is addictive.

The good news is that current research suggests melatonin is not addictive. Unlike many prescription sleeping pills, melatonin does not appear to cause cravings or drug dependence.

However, some people may become psychologically dependent. This means they may feel they cannot sleep without taking a supplement, even if their body no longer needs it.

If you find yourself relying on melatonin every night, it’s worth looking at your sleep habits and the underlying cause of your sleep problem.

What Research Says

Current studies have not shown evidence of physical dependence or withdrawal symptoms when melatonin is stopped after short-term use. More research is still needed on long-term use.

Melatonin is one of the most studied sleep supplements, with thousands of research papers published over the past several decades.

Current evidence shows that melatonin works best for problems related to the body’s internal clock, such as jet lag and certain circadian rhythm sleep disorders.

For general insomnia, the benefits are usually modest and vary from person to person. It is not considered a first-line treatment for chronic insomnia in most adults.

Researchers are also studying melatonin for conditions such as healthy aging, migraine prevention, brain health, immune function, and cancer supportive care. While some early findings are promising, there is not enough evidence to recommend melatonin for these purposes.

What This Means for You

Current research supports using melatonin for the right person, at the right time, and for the right reason. It should be part of an overall sleep plan, not a replacement for healthy sleep habits or medical care.
